Five Facts About Pope Leo XIV

Cardinal Robert Francis Prevost, an American, was elected the 267th pontiff of the Roman Catholic Church, on Thursday.

Following his election, he took the name Pope Leo XIV. Prevost is the first American ever to ascend to the papacy.

The announcement was made from the balcony of St. Peter’s Basilica after the traditional white smoke billowed from the Sistine Chapel, was met with applause and awe.

Here are some interesting facts about the new pope:

First American Pope

Pope Leo XIV was born on September 14, 1955, in Chicago, Illinois. He is not only the first American but also one of a very few non-Europeans to lead the Catholic Church.

Scholar and Mathematician

Before embracing religious life, Pope Leo XIV earned a Bachelor of Science in Mathematics from Villanova University.

He continued his academic path through theological and canonical studies, culminating in a Doctorate in Canon Law from the Pontifical University of Saint Thomas Aquinas in Rome.

He’s Multilingual

Pope Leo XIV speaks English, Spanish, Italian, French, and Portuguese, and can read Latin and German.

This was reflected in his international pastoral experience and academic background.

Ordained Priest In 1982

After his ordination in 1982, Prevost joined the Augustinian mission in Peru in 1985 and served as chancellor of the Territorial Prélature of Chulucanas from 1985 to 1986.

Pope Leo XIV was ordained into the Order of St. Augustine and served extensively in Peru, where he was appointed Bishop of Chiclayo in 2015.

His time in South America shaped his concern for indigenous rights, environmental stewardship, and poverty alleviation.

Appointed Cardinal In 2023

Pope Francis appointed Prevost prefect of the Dicastery for Bishops in January 2023, a powerful position responsible for selecting bishops, a position he held until Pope Francis died on April 21, 2025.

On September 30, 2023, Pope Francis elevated Prevost to the rank of Cardinal.
